In a world where the line between human and monster blurs, Sachi possesses a unique and insatiable hunger that sets her apart. Far from a mere craving, her monstrous appetite dictates her very existence, pushing the boundaries of what it means to survive and thrive in a society that often fears what it doesn't understand. Her journey is one of constant negotiation with her own nature, seeking to satisfy her urges without sacrificing her humanity. This compelling narrative delves into the complexities of identity when faced with extraordinary circumstances. As Sachi navigates her peculiar dietary needs, she encounters a diverse cast of characters, each with their own secrets and struggles. Her quest for sustenance becomes a metaphor for self-acceptance and the search for belonging in a world that isn't always ready to embrace the unconventional.
